The word
"cracker" has different meanings depending on the context. In the context of food, a
cracker refers to a type of baked snack that is usually dry, crispy, and can be eaten on its own or with toppings. In some places, the term
"cracker" is also used as a slang term to refer to a person from the southern United States. However, it is important to note that this term can be considered offensive to some people, so it's better to be cautious when using it.
